The Lone Ranger Comic Album #6

Jan 1962 · World Distributors · 2/6 [0-2-6 GBP]
“Into Death Valley”

"Into Death Valley" kicks off in 1962 with a tense showdown at a remote cabin tied to the Lone Ranger’s hidden silver mine. When outlaws take Jim hostage and discover the cabin’s secret door, Dan Reid must stay hidden in the mine shaft, relying on stealth and cunning to survive. Written by Paul S. Newman and illustrated by Tom Gill—whose dynamic art brings the perilous landscape to life—this issue delivers classic Western suspense with a clever twist. Cover by Tom Gill.
